Unit 1 Boiler. The boiler house at Ferrybridge C Power Station contained the steam generating boilers and pulverised fuel mills. The four boiler units were manufactured by Babcock and Wilcox, were the single furnace, front wall fired, natural circulation type. They had a minimum efficiency of 76%, rising to % at continuous maximum rating.

A pulverized coalfired boiler is an industrial or utility boiler that generates thermal energy by burning pulverized coal (also known as powdered coal or coal dust since it is as fine as face powder in cosmetic makeup) that is blown into the firebox.. The basic idea of a firing system using pulverised fuel is to use the whole volume of the furnace for the combustion of solid fuels.
